Clojure Tutorial Part 0. Создание окружения Установите инструменты clojure и Temurin.


Пререквизиты.

M1 Мак

macOS Monterey ver 12.4

Внутренняя установка с помощью brew on


Установите clojure/tools/clojure с помощью arm64 brew

https://clojure.org/guides/install_clojure

Обратитесь к официальной документации по clojure

brew --version
Homebrew 3.2.16
Войдите в полноэкранный режим Выход из полноэкранного режима

Сначала проверьте, установлена ли пивоварня

arch -arm64 brew install clojure/tools/clojure
Войдите в полноэкранный режим Выход из полноэкранного режима

Установите инструменты clojure с описанием arm64.

Не проверялось, можно ли использовать команду clj на данном этапе.


Темурин 17 с бочкой для явы 17.

https://qiita.com/tearoom6/items/1abf24ca6d872e6579b0#brew-tap

tap — это команда для установки неофициальных инструментов brew.

https://eng.shibuya24.info/entry/homebrew-cask

cask — это инструмент для установки GUI-приложений через brew.

brew tap homebrew/cask-versions
...
Resolving deltas: 100% (170387/170387), done.
Tapped 219 casks (249 files, 70MB).
Войдите в полноэкранный режим Выход из полноэкранного режима

Это позволит вам использовать бочки.

brew install --cask temurin17
...
==> Installing Cask temurin17

installer: Package name is Eclipse Temurin
installer: Installing at base path /
installer: The install was successful.
🍺  temurin17 was successfully installed!
Войдите в полноэкранный режим Выход из полноэкранного режима

temurin 17 теперь установлен.

java --version
openjdk 17.0.3 2022-04-19
OpenJDK Runtime Environment Temurin-17.0.3+7 (build 17.0.3+7)
OpenJDK 64-Bit Server VM Temurin-17.0.3+7 (build 17.0.3+7, mixed mode, sharing)
Войдите в полноэкранный режим Выход из полноэкранного режима

Проверьте версию java.
Temurin 17, который был установлен ранее, установлен.
Java также 17.

JAVA_HOME не может быть отображен, что немного беспокоит.


Проверьте версию clojure.

clj --version 
Clojure CLI version 1.11.1.1113
Войдите в полноэкранный режим Выход из полноэкранного режима

Используйте команду clj или clojure, чтобы проверить, что вы находитесь в версии 1.11 Clojure CLI.
Я смог подтвердить, что Clojure CLI версии 1.11 был включен.

Интерпретируйте это как то, что создание среды Clojure на данный момент завершено.


Резюме.

Чтобы получить Clojure на M1 Mac

arm64 brew clojure/tools/clojure

Темурин 17 с заваркой (бочка).

После этого java 17 будет установлена, и вы сможете использовать команды clojure.

Оцените статью
Procodings.ru
Добавить комментарий